-
公开(公告)号:US11093504B2
公开(公告)日:2021-08-17
申请号:US16700434
申请日:2019-12-02
Applicant: BUSINESS OBJECTS SOFTWARE LTD.
Inventor: Ping Xiang , Semuel Kadarusman , Patrick Wang , Justin Wong , Veljko Jovanovic
IPC: G06F15/16 , G06F16/2455
Abstract: Some embodiments provide execution of a query on a target data model which is filtered on a measure of a source data model, even if the source data model and the target data model are not logically linked. Some embodiments further support execution of a query on a target data model which is filtered on a measure of a source data model and on a dimension filter of another data model. Some embodiments provide for a substantial amount of query execution to occur on the backend, thereby freeing client resources in comparison to prior approaches.
-
公开(公告)号:US20210165828A1
公开(公告)日:2021-06-03
申请号:US16700434
申请日:2019-12-02
Applicant: BUSINESS OBJECTS SOFTWARE LTD.
Inventor: Ping Xiang , Semuel Kadarusman , Patrick Wang , Justin Wong , Veljko Jovanovic
IPC: G06F16/9035 , G06F16/22 , G06F16/2455
Abstract: Some embodiments provide execution of a query on a target data model which is filtered on a measure of a source data model, even if the source data model and the target data model are not logically linked. Some embodiments further support execution of a query on a target data model which is filtered on a measure of a source data model and on a dimension filter of another data model. Some embodiments provide for a substantial amount of query execution to occur on the backend, thereby freeing client resources in comparison to prior approaches.
-
公开(公告)号:US20210073230A1
公开(公告)日:2021-03-11
申请号:US16563200
申请日:2019-09-06
Applicant: BUSINESS OBJECTS SOFTWARE LTD.
Inventor: Ping Xiang , Semuel Kadarusman , Patrick Wang , Justin Wong , Veljko Jovanovic
IPC: G06F16/2453 , G06F16/248 , G06F16/21 , G06F16/22 , G06F16/2455
Abstract: A system includes reception of a filter on a first dimension of a first data model, determination of an association between a second dimension of the first data model and a first dimension of a second data model, generation of a calculated dimension based on the second dimension, the rows of the calculated dimension being identical to the rows of the first dimension, application of the filter to the rows of the calculated dimension to generate filtered rows of the calculated dimension, execution of an inner join between the filtered rows of the calculated dimension and a fact table of the second data model to generate a result table including one or more measure values of the second data model, and generation of a visualization including the result table.
-
公开(公告)号:US12130828B2
公开(公告)日:2024-10-29
申请号:US17529006
申请日:2021-11-17
Applicant: Business Objects Software Ltd.
Inventor: Justin Wong , Rui Liu , Clarence Chuahuico , Semuel Kadarusman , Veljko Jovanovic
IPC: G06F16/248 , G06F16/242 , G06F16/25 , G06F16/26
CPC classification number: G06F16/248 , G06F16/242 , G06F16/258 , G06F16/26
Abstract: Some embodiments provide a program that generates a first query for a first visualization based on a first query model associated with the first visualization. The first query model includes a first reference to a shared object. The program further sends the first query to a computing system. The program also receives from the computing system a first set of data. The program further generates the first visualization based on the first set of data. The program also generates a second query for a second visualization based on a second query model associated with the second visualization. The second query model includes a second reference to the shared object. The program further sends the second query to the computing system. The program also receives from the computing system a second set of data. The program further generates the second visualization based on the second set of data.
-
公开(公告)号:US20230062012A1
公开(公告)日:2023-03-02
申请号:US17529006
申请日:2021-11-17
Applicant: Business Objects Software Ltd.
Inventor: Justin Wong , Rui Liu , Clarence Chuahuico , Semuel Kadarusman , Veljko Jovanovic
IPC: G06F16/248 , G06F16/26 , G06F16/242 , G06F16/25
Abstract: Some embodiments provide a program that generates a first query for a first visualization based on a first query model associated with the first visualization. The first query model includes a first reference to a shared object. The program further sends the first query to a computing system. The program also receives from the computing system a first set of data. The program further generates the first visualization based on the first set of data. The program also generates a second query for a second visualization based on a second query model associated with the second visualization. The second query model includes a second reference to the shared object. The program further sends the second query to the computing system. The program also receives from the computing system a second set of data. The program further generates the second visualization based on the second set of data.
-
公开(公告)号:US11200236B2
公开(公告)日:2021-12-14
申请号:US16563200
申请日:2019-09-06
Applicant: BUSINESS OBJECTS SOFTWARE LTD.
Inventor: Ping Xiang , Semuel Kadarusman , Patrick Wang , Justin Wong , Veljko Jovanovic
IPC: G06F3/048 , G06F16/2453 , G06F16/248 , G06F16/2455 , G06F16/22 , G06F16/21
Abstract: A system includes reception of a filter on a first dimension of a first data model, determination of an association between a second dimension of the first data model and a first dimension of a second data model, generation of a calculated dimension based on the second dimension, the rows of the calculated dimension being identical to the rows of the first dimension, application of the filter to the rows of the calculated dimension to generate filtered rows of the calculated dimension, execution of an inner join between the filtered rows of the calculated dimension and a fact table of the second data model to generate a result table including one or more measure values of the second data model, and generation of a visualization including the result table.
-
-
-
-
-